Sony Ericsson Smartphone based on Android 2.0

May 23rd, 2009 | Filed under Mobile Phones 1 Comment

At the presentation of Sony Ericsson in Taiwan, which they was carried out to demonstrate products, ePrice has a small interview with Vice President of Marketing Peter Ang. He said that the company plans to release new models that are running operating systems, Symbian and Windows Mobile, however, the basic resources are directed towards the development of Android smartphone. Comprehensive information about the characteristics and timing of the release device Peter Ang did not provide. He only mentioned that it will be released shortly. Interestingly, however, the smartphone will be based at the new platform, Android 2.0. In addition, the unit will support “Sony Ericsson’s unique style“, probably refers to the user interface developed by the company in addition to the operating system.

Remember, the network has the information about updating Android under the number 2.0. It is also known under the code name Donut. It is anticipated that the operating system will be more functional than the Android 1.0 and 1.5. For example, its capacity features will support WVGA display. It is also expected that the Android smartphones series manufacturers; Motorola, Sony Ericsson, Acer, and others, which they will be released in the second half of this year, will soon be based on the Android 2.0 Donut.
